Job Title:

Propulsion Staff Engineer - Thruster Systems

Job Description

The Propulsion Staff Engineer - Thruster Systems owns the end-to-end technical execution of bipropellant thruster systems, from requirements definition through design, build, integration, test, and flight readiness. This role leads cross‑functional teams and external suppliers to deliver high‑performance thruster hardware that meets aggressive cost and schedule targets while maintaining rigorous safety, quality, and configuration control standards. The position is ideal for a hands‑on propulsion expert who combines deep technical capability with strong leadership, clear communication, and a decisive bias toward execution and delivery.

Responsibilities

+ Own the end-to-end technical execution of bipropellant thruster systems and propellant feed systems, from requirements definition through design, build, integration, test, and flight readiness.

+ Serve as the subject matter expert for propellant feed systems, acting as the technical authority on system architecture, pressure vessels (COPVs and tanks), flow control components (valves and regulators), and instrumentation across the full development lifecycle.

+ Lead technical delivery to meet performance, safety, cost, and schedule objectives for thruster and feed system hardware.

+ Plan, assign, and coordinate work across internal team members and cross‑functional partners, leading daily standups and proactively escalating risks, issues, and blockers.

+ Develop and manage execution plans, schedules, and priorities to achieve critical program milestones for thruster and propulsion subsystems.

+ Provide technical leadership, guidance, and mentorship to early‑career engineers working on propulsion systems and related subsystems.

+ Lead and actively participate in design reviews, gate reviews, and technical forums with internal and external stakeholders, ensuring robust technical decisions and configuration control.

+ Drive trade studies, component selection, subassembly design and integration, analysis, and testing for thrusters, feed systems, and associated hardware.

+ Coordinate with suppliers on design, manufacturing, and verification activities, ensuring components meet technical, quality, and schedule requirements.

+ Apply modeling, analysis, and simulation tools to predict system performance and verify compliance with requirements, including thermal, fluid, and structural considerations.

+ Develop and execute test campaigns, including test planning, instrumentation selection, data collection, and data correlation for thrusters and propulsion components.

+ Oversee integration of propulsion components such as injectors, combustion chambers, nozzles, igniters, valves, filters, regulators, manifolds, and instrumentation into complete thruster assemblies.

+ Maintain rigorous safety, quality, and configuration control standards throughout design, build, test, and flight readiness activities.

+ Collaborate closely with propulsion engineers and multidisciplinary teams to support station and next‑generation space station programs.
